What are interactive avatars?
Interactive avatars are digital characters capable of communicating with users through voice, motion, gestures, expressions, and real-time interaction. They can appear inside virtual worlds, mixed reality environments, web-based 3D spaces, kiosks, or mobile applications.
These avatars leverage immersive engines and AI systems similar to the tools highlighted on the Mimic Immersive tech page, where spatial environments, character systems, and real-time interaction frameworks form the foundation of user engagement.
Interactive avatars combine visual identity, personality design, and intelligent behavior to make digital experiences feel more human.

Interactive avatars inside VR, AR, and mixed reality
Immersive technologies increase the impact of interactive avatars by placing them directly inside the user’s environment.
Examples include:
VR
avatar tour guides
training instructors
virtual showroom hosts
AR
product demonstration companions
task guidance
real world overlay communication
MR
spatial assistants that interact with real objects
on site training support
holographic brand ambassadors
These avatars enhance immersion and give users the sense of interacting with a live representative.

How do avatars create emotional presence?
Emotional presence is what makes interactive avatars so effective. Avatars convey:
eye contact
natural hand movement
facial expressions
tone and pacing
These emotional signals make communication feel engaging, not robotic. Users develop trust faster and stay longer in experiences hosted by avatars.
Presence is a key factor in aligning brand tone with user satisfaction.
